Внимание! center-referat.ru не продает дипломы, аттестаты об образовании и иные документы об образовании. Все услуги на сайте предоставляются исключительно в рамках законодательства.
Дипломная работа - Написание экспертной системы на языке Turbo-Prolog
Программа также должна во время консультации выводить заключения из информации, имеющейся в базе знаний.
Некоторые экспертные системы могут также использовать новую информацию, добавляемую во время консультации.
Экспертную систему, таким образом, можно представлять состоящей из трех частей: 1. База знаний (БЗ). 2. Механизм вывода (МВ). 3. Система пользовательского интерфейса (СПИ). База знаний - центральная часть экспертной системы. Она содержит правила, описывающие отношения или явления, методы и знания для решения задач из области применения системы. Можно представлять базу знаний состоящей из фактических знаний и зна ний, которые используются для вывода других знаний.
Утверждение 'Джон Ф. Кеннеди был 35-м президентом Соединенных Штатов' - пример фактического знания. 'Если у вас болит голова,то примите две таблетки цитрамона' - пример знания для вывода. Сама база знаний обычно располагается на диске или другом носителе.
Механизм вывода содержит принципы и правила работы.
Механизм вывода 'знает', как использовать базу знаний так, чтобы можно было получать разумно согласующиеся заключения (выводы) из информации, находящейся в ней. Когда экспертной системе задается вопрос, механизм вывода выбирает способ применения правил базы знаний для решения задачи, поставленной в вопросе.
Фактически, механизм вывода запускает экспертную систему в работу, определяя какие правила нужно вызвать и организуя к ним доступ в базу знаний.
Механизм вывода выполняет правила, определяет когда найдено приемлемое решение и передает результаты программе интерфейса с пользователем. Когда вопрос должен быть предварительно обработан, то доступ к базе знаний осуществляется через интерфейс с пользователем.
Интерфейс - это часть экспертной системы, которая взаимодействует с пользователем.
Система интерфейса с пользователем принимает информацию от пользователя и передает ему информацию.
Просто говоря, система интерфейса должна убедиться, что, после того как пользователь ...